filename.h

Enumerado wxPosixPermissions

enum  	wxPosixPermissions {
  wxS_IRUSR = 00400 ,
  wxS_IWUSR = 00200 ,
  wxS_IXUSR = 00100 ,
  wxS_IRGRP = 00040 ,
  wxS_IWGRP = 00020 ,
  wxS_IXGRP = 00010 ,
  wxS_IROTH = 00004 ,
  wxS_IWOTH = 00002 ,
  wxS_IXOTH = 00001 ,
  wxPOSIX_USER_READ = wxS_IRUSR ,
  wxPOSIX_USER_WRITE = wxS_IWUSR ,
  wxPOSIX_USER_EXECUTE = wxS_IXUSR ,
  wxPOSIX_GROUP_READ = wxS_IRGRP ,
  wxPOSIX_GROUP_WRITE = wxS_IWGRP ,
  wxPOSIX_GROUP_EXECUTE = wxS_IXGRP ,
  wxPOSIX_OTHERS_READ = wxS_IROTH ,
  wxPOSIX_OTHERS_WRITE = wxS_IWOTH ,
  wxPOSIX_OTHERS_EXECUTE = wxS_IXOTH ,
  wxS_DEFAULT ,
  wxS_DIR_DEFAULT
}

Nombres de bits de permisos de archivo.

Se defininen estas constantes en wxWidgets porque S_IREAD &c no son estándar. Sin embargo, se asume que los valores corresponden a los bits umask de Unix.

Miembros/valores

wxS_IRUSR
Nombres POSIX estándar para estos indicadores de permiso con el prefijo "wx".
wxS_IWUSR
Nombres POSIX estándar para estos indicadores de permiso con el prefijo "wx".
wxS_IXUSR
Nombres POSIX estándar para estos indicadores de permiso con el prefijo "wx".
wxS_IRGRP
Nombres POSIX estándar para estos indicadores de permiso con el prefijo "wx".
wxS_IWGRP
Nombres POSIX estándar para estos indicadores de permiso con el prefijo "wx".
wxS_IXGRP
Nombres POSIX estándar para estos indicadores de permiso con el prefijo "wx".
wxS_IROTH
Nombres POSIX estándar para estos indicadores de permiso con el prefijo "wx".
wxS_IWOTH
Nombres POSIX estándar para estos indicadores de permiso con el prefijo "wx".
wxS_IXOTH
Nombres POSIX estándar para estos indicadores de permiso con el prefijo "wx".
wxPOSIX_USER_READ
Sinónimos más largos pero más legibles para las constantes anteriores.
wxPOSIX_USER_WRITE
Sinónimos más largos pero más legibles para las constantes anteriores.
wxPOSIX_USER_EXECUTE
Sinónimos más largos pero más legibles para las constantes anteriores.
wxPOSIX_GROUP_READ
Sinónimos más largos pero más legibles para las constantes anteriores.
wxPOSIX_GROUP_WRITE
Sinónimos más largos pero más legibles para las constantes anteriores.
wxPOSIX_GROUP_EXECUTE
Sinónimos más largos pero más legibles para las constantes anteriores.
wxPOSIX_OTHERS_READ
Sinónimos más largos pero más legibles para las constantes anteriores.
wxPOSIX_OTHERS_WRITE
Sinónimos más largos pero más legibles para las constantes anteriores.
wxPOSIX_OTHERS_EXECUTE
Sinónimos más largos pero más legibles para las constantes anteriores.
wxS_DEFAULT
Modo predeterminado para los nuevos archivos: permite la lectura/escritura a todo el mundo, pero el modo de archivo efectivo se establecerá después de realizar una operación AND con este valor y umask, por lo que no incluirá wxS_IW{GRP,OTH} para el valor predeterminado de umask 022.
wxS_DIR_DEFAULT
Modo predeterminado para los nuevos directorios (véase wxFileName::Mkdir): permite la lectura/escritura/ejecución a todo el mundo, pero al igual que wxS_DEFAULT, el modo de directorio efectivo se establecerá después de realizar una operación AND entre este valor y umask.